VBoxManage下载与使用指南:虚拟化管理的利器
VBoxManage下载与使用指南:虚拟化管理的利器
在虚拟化技术日益普及的今天,VBoxManage 作为VirtualBox的命令行管理工具,成为了许多IT专业人士和开发者的得力助手。本文将详细介绍VBoxManage下载的相关信息及其应用场景,帮助大家更好地利用这一强大的工具。
VBoxManage是什么?
VBoxManage 是Oracle VM VirtualBox自带的一个命令行工具,它允许用户通过命令行界面管理虚拟机(VM)。与图形用户界面(GUI)相比,VBoxManage 提供了更细粒度的控制和自动化管理的可能性。
VBoxManage下载
VBoxManage 无需单独下载,因为它是VirtualBox安装包的一部分。用户在安装VirtualBox时,VBoxManage 会自动安装到系统中。以下是获取VBoxManage 的步骤:
-
下载VirtualBox:访问Oracle的官方网站,下载适合您操作系统的VirtualBox安装包。
-
安装VirtualBox:按照安装向导完成安装,确保选择安装所有组件,包括命令行工具。
-
验证安装:安装完成后,打开命令行终端,输入
VBoxManage --version
来确认VBoxManage 是否已正确安装。
VBoxManage的应用场景
VBoxManage 的应用非常广泛,以下是一些常见的使用场景:
-
虚拟机管理:创建、启动、停止、删除虚拟机,修改虚拟机配置等。
-
快照管理:创建、恢复、删除虚拟机快照,方便在不同状态之间切换。
-
网络配置:设置虚拟机的网络模式,如NAT、桥接、内部网络等。
-
共享文件夹:配置虚拟机与宿主机之间的文件共享。
-
自动化脚本:编写脚本自动化虚拟机的创建和管理,提高工作效率。
-
远程管理:通过VBoxManage的远程功能,管理位于其他机器上的VirtualBox实例。
使用示例
以下是一些常用的VBoxManage 命令示例:
-
创建虚拟机:
VBoxManage createvm --name "MyVM" --register
-
启动虚拟机:
VBoxManage startvm "MyVM" --type headless
-
创建快照:
VBoxManage snapshot "MyVM" take "SnapshotName"
-
配置共享文件夹:
VBoxManage sharedfolder add "MyVM" --name "share" --hostpath "/path/to/share"
注意事项
使用VBoxManage 时需要注意以下几点:
-
权限:某些操作需要管理员权限,确保以适当的权限运行命令。
-
命令格式:命令格式严格,参数顺序和格式错误会导致命令执行失败。
-
安全性:在使用远程管理功能时,确保网络安全,避免未授权访问。
-
备份:在进行重大操作前,建议备份虚拟机配置和数据。
总结
VBoxManage 作为VirtualBox的命令行工具,为用户提供了强大的虚拟机管理能力。通过本文的介绍,希望大家能够掌握VBoxManage下载和使用的基本知识,进而在实际工作中灵活运用,提高虚拟化管理的效率和安全性。无论是日常的虚拟机维护,还是复杂的自动化部署,VBoxManage 都是不可或缺的工具。